Abstract
A method of managing at least one vehicle includes sensing a tire operating characteristic of the at least one vehicle, sensing a vehicle operating characteristic of the at least one vehicle, and providing an output. The output is indicative of an expected tire life, and is based on the tire operating characteristic and the vehicle operating characteristic of the at least one vehicle.

32. A system for monitoring vehicle conditions of at least one vehicle, comprising:
-
a vehicle sensor configured to sense at least one vehicle operating characteristic of the at least one vehicle;
a tire sensor configured to sense at least one tire operating characteristic of the at least one vehicle;
a controller in communication with each of the tire and vehicle sensors of the at least one vehicle; and
a central processor in communication with the controller and configured to calculate an expected tire life of the at least one vehicle based on the at least one vehicle operating characteristic and the at least one tire operating characteristic. - View Dependent Claims (33, 34, 35, 36, 37, 38, 39)
